The morning sun casts long shadows across the golden-hued sands of Taulud Island Beach, illuminating the ancient coral stone buildings of Massawa in the distance. This isn't your typical secluded escape; instead, Taulud offers a captivating urban island experience, where history whispers on the breeze and the Red Sea gently laps at a shoreline steeped in stories. OnlyBeaches recognizes its unique appeal, giving Taulud Island Beach an impressive OBI score of 8.9, placing it firmly in our Tier A category for its distinctive blend of scenic beauty and cultural significance.
The waters here are typically calm and inviting, perfect for a refreshing dip or a leisurely swim, reflecting the clear, azure tones characteristic of the Red Sea. The sand, a soft, fine grain, provides a comfortable expanse for sunbathing or a contemplative stroll along the water's edge. While not known for surf, the gentle undulations are ideal for families and those seeking tranquil aquatic moments. The best time to visit is during the early morning or late afternoon, when the light is soft, and the temperatures are most pleasant, allowing for comfortable exploration and photography.

Yes, the waters of the red sea at taulud island beach are typically calm and clear, making them generally safe and pleasant for swimming.
The cooler months from october to april are ideal, offering more comfortable temperatures for enjoying the beach and exploring massawa.
Taulud island beach is easily accessible by a short walk or drive from massawa's city center, as it's part of the urban island landscape.
As an urban beach, basic facilities like local eateries and shops are typically available nearby, though dedicated beach amenities may be limited.
Policies on dogs can vary; it's advisable to check locally upon arrival, as specific dog-friendly designations are not widely published.
The historic city of massawa, with its unique ottoman and italian colonial architecture, bustling markets, and waterfront restaurants, is just steps away.
